<description>Are you working on your '09 budget? Are you planning a BPM project or maybe even a broader process improvement initiative in ‘09? Budgeting for BPM is different than budgeting for traditional “one and done” projects.  A BPM project usually follows an iterative approach, which means that the project isn’t over once the process is first deployed. In fact, the project is just getting started!

Come hear from Toby Cappello, VP of Professional Services, as he gives his perspective on the best way to budget for your process improvement initiative.
